Output 5ccbca0105ce89fa6a89dbf4eeecd8bcfaba5818631d17309e49de0d9a2eccd3:27
- value
- 20495537
- script pubkey
- OP_0 OP_PUSHBYTES_20 e687628c6289bae96cb12271e63d05cb059e6c0d
- address
- bc1qu6rk9rrz3xawjm93yfc7v0g9evzeumqdcjkv33
- transaction
- 5ccbca0105ce89fa6a89dbf4eeecd8bcfaba5818631d17309e49de0d9a2eccd3
- confirmations
- 253803
- spent
- true